Theoretical Connotation and Textual Analysis Paradigm Construction of "Affective Narration" in Literary Studies
View through CrossRef
This paper explores the theoretical connotation of "affective narration" in literary studies and constructs a textual analysis paradigm based on affective narration. By analyzing the definition and characteristics of affective narration and combining practical cases in literary and artistic works, it deeply discusses how emotions function in narration. The purpose of this paper is to promote the academic research process of affective narration through a detailed theoretical and textual analysis framework, and to provide a new analytical perspective for the research of literary, film and other artistic forms.
